What is a Jointer?

A jointer is a woodworking machine used to produce a flat surface along a board's length. This flat surface is essential for ensuring that boards fit together perfectly when making furniture, cabinets, or other wood constructions. Jointers are also used to straighten edges and flatten faces of boards, which is a critical step before further processing with other tools such as planers or table saws.

Key Components of a Jointer

Cutter Head: The cutter head contains the blades that cut the wood. It rotates at high speeds to remove material and create a flat surface.

Infeed Table: The infeed table supports the wood as it is fed into the cutter head. The height of the infeed table determines the depth of the cut.

Outfeed Table: The outfeed table supports the wood after it has passed through the cutter head. It is set at the same height as the cutter head to ensure a smooth, flat finish.

Fence: The fence is an adjustable guide that helps keep the wood aligned during the cutting process. It can be tilted to create bevels or chamfers on the edges of the wood.

Using a Jointer in Construction

Preparing the Wood

Before using a jointer, it's important to inspect the wood for any defects, such as knots or cracks, and remove any debris or foreign objects that could damage the blades. The wood should also be of a manageable size and weight to ensure safe and effective operation.

Setting Up the Jointer

Adjust the Infeed Table: Set the infeed table to the desired depth of cut. For initial flattening, a deeper cut may be needed, but for finishing passes, a shallower cut is recommended to ensure a smooth surface.

Check the Fence: Adjust the fence to the correct angle and ensure it is securely locked in place. For most operations, the fence should be set at 90 degrees to the tables, but it can be tilted for angled cuts.

Inspect the Blades: Ensure the cutter head blades are sharp and properly aligned. Dull or misaligned blades can result in poor cuts and may damage the wood.

Operating the Jointer

Safety First: Wear appropriate safety gear, including safety glasses and hearing protection. Keep hands and fingers away from the cutter head and use push blocks or push sticks to guide the wood.

Feeding the Wood: Place the wood on the infeed table with the edge to be jointed against the fence. Apply steady pressure and feed the wood into the cutter head. Move at a consistent speed to ensure an even cut.

Finishing the Cut: As the wood passes over the cutter head and onto the outfeed table, maintain pressure and control to ensure a smooth transition. The outfeed table should be level with the cutter head to support the wood and prevent snipe (a tapered cut at the end of the board).

Applications of Jointers in Construction

Edge Jointing

Edge jointing is the process of creating a flat, square edge on a board. This is essential for joining two or more boards together to create wider panels. By ensuring that the edges are perfectly straight and square, jointers help create strong, seamless joints that enhance the overall strength and appearance of the construction.

Face Jointing

Face jointing involves flattening one face of a board. This is usually the first step in preparing rough lumber for further processing. A flat face is essential for accurate measurements and cuts in subsequent steps, such as planing and ripping.

Beveling and Chamfering

Jointers can also be used to create bevels and chamfers on the edges of boards. By tilting the fence, woodworkers can cut angled edges that are often used for decorative purposes or to create specific joint types. This versatility makes jointers invaluable in both functional and aesthetic aspects of woodworking.

Choosing the Right Jointer

Benchtop Jointers

Benchtop jointers are ideal for smaller workshops and DIY enthusiasts. They offer portability and ease of use without compromising on precision. When selecting a benchtop jointer, consider the following factors:

Cutter Head Type: Benchtop jointers typically come with straight knives or spiral cutter heads. Spiral cutter heads are more expensive but provide cleaner cuts and are quieter in operation.
Motor Power: Ensure the motor is powerful enough to handle the type of wood and the depth of cuts you plan to make. A motor with at least 1 HP is recommended for most benchtop jointers.
Table Size: The size of the infeed and outfeed tables will determine the maximum length of the boards you can work with. Larger tables provide better support and stability.

Floor-Standing Jointers

For larger projects and professional use, floor-standing jointers offer greater capacity and durability. When choosing a floor-standing jointer, consider the following:

Cutting Width: The cutting width will determine the maximum width of the boards you can joint. Common widths range from 6 to 12 inches, with wider models available for specialized applications.
Fence Adjustability: A robust and adjustable fence is crucial for accurate jointing. Look for fences that are easy to adjust and lock securely in place.
Dust Collection: Effective dust collection is important for maintaining a clean and safe workspace. Ensure the jointer is compatible with your dust collection system.

Maintenance and Care

Blade Maintenance

Keeping the blades sharp and properly aligned is essential for achieving clean, precise cuts. Regularly inspect the blades for wear and damage, and replace them as needed. Some jointers come with self-indexing blades, making it easier to maintain alignment.

Table and Fence Maintenance

The infeed and outfeed tables, as well as the fence, should be kept clean and free of debris. Periodically check for flatness and alignment to ensure accurate cuts. Apply a thin coat of wax to the tables to reduce friction and prevent rust.

Motor and Electrical Components

Ensure the motor and electrical components are in good working order when ready. Regularly check for loose connections, frayed wires, and other potential issues. Keep the motor clean and free of dust to prevent overheating.

Common Challenges and Solutions

Tear-Out and Chipping

Tear-out and chipping can occur when jointing boards with figured or grainy wood. To minimize these issues, use sharp blades and take shallow cuts. Additionally, feeding the wood in the direction of the grain can help reduce tear-out.

Snipe

Snipe is a common issue where the ends of the boards are cut deeper than the rest. This is often caused by improper support or uneven tables. Ensure the infeed and outfeed tables are level, ready, and provide adequate support for the entire length of the board.

Blade Alignment

Misaligned blades can result in uneven cuts and poor surface finish. Regularly check and adjust the blade alignment to ensure they are ready and consistent and accurate cuts. Some jointers come with self-indexing blades that simplify this process.
